The musical Fan letter is back for a 10th-anniversary encore, ready to move audiences all over again.

After wrapping its 10th-anniversary performance at the Seoul Arts Center on February 22, Fan letter shifts to the Daehak-ro Grand Theater starting on the 17th.

This season, producer Live Co., Ltd. expanded fan engagement with interactive events inspired by the show’s world-building and characters. The lineup lets audiences step into key moments and feel the narrative flow firsthand.

First up were pre-show events built around symbolic in-story dates. On the 4th, a 'Hikaru Birthday Party' celebrated the character Hikaru, with actors in the role gifting manuscript-paper-shaped cookies and postcards to fans. Around Daehak-ro, a street activation invited fans to find staff dressed in character Sehun’s stage costume and hand them a fan letter to receive manuscript-paper cookies and discount vouchers — a real-life spin on the show’s core motif of letters.

Special opening-week surprises continue. From the 17th to the 19th, the 'Haejin’s Letter Giveaway' will present paid ticket holders for those performances with a letter handwritten by the actor playing Kim Haejin, bringing the show’s emotions even closer.

An experiential pop-up has also opened near the venue. On the skybridge at Hongik University Daehangno Art Center, the 'Myeongil Daily News Editorial Room' pop-up zone features show MD sales, a space where visitors can write their own letters, and shelves to browse books related to 'Guinhoe' — the real-life literary circle that inspired the production. There’s also a screening area to revisit performance videos and music from the past decade, offering a look back at the history of Fan letter.

Meanwhile, the 10th-anniversary encore run of Fan letter begins on the 17th and continues through June 7 at the Grand Theater of Hongik University Daehangno Art Center in Seoul.
